Northridge Whips Pacific Lutheran in Soccer Opener

Jim Hofferber and Scott Piri each scored two goals to lead Cal State Northridge to a 5-1 victory over Pacific Lutheran in the first round of the Far West Classic soccer tournament Thursday at Chico State.
The match was also the season opener for the Matadors, who play Simon Fraser University of British Columbia in the second round at 3:30 this afternoon.
Pacific Lutheran scored first less than two minutes into the game but hardly threatened thereafter. Hofferber, a sophomore forward, scored moments later to tie the score. After the go-ahead goal by junior Bill Durkin, Hofferber scored again just before halftime to give the Matadors a 3-1 advantage.
Piri, a freshman midfielder, completed the scoring with a pair of second-half goals. He also assisted on CSUN’s first goal.
Bernie Lilavois, Bobby Reyes, German Leverde and John Alevras each had an assist for the Matadors. Goalie Jeff Blumkin made eight saves.
